Sunghoon Park is a scholar working on Molecular Biology, Biomedical Engineering and Materials Chemistry. According to data from OpenAlex, Sunghoon Park has authored 115 papers receiving a total of 3.0k indexed citations (citations by other indexed papers that have themselves been cited), including 92 papers in Molecular Biology, 29 papers in Biomedical Engineering and 17 papers in Materials Chemistry. Recurrent topics in Sunghoon Park’s work include Metabolic Engineering and Synthetic Biology (54 papers), Enzyme Immobilization Techniques (34 papers) and Biofuel production and bioconversion (26 papers). Sunghoon Park is often cited by papers focused on Metabolic Engineering and Synthetic Biology (54 papers), Enzyme Immobilization Techniques (34 papers) and Biofuel production and bioconversion (26 papers). Sunghoon Park collaborates with scholars based in South Korea, United States and China. Sunghoon Park's co-authors include Eun Yeol Lee, Kwan‐Hwa Park, Satish Kumar Ainala, Eunhee Seol and Somasundar Ashok and has published in prestigious journals such as Nano Letters, PLoS ONE and Applied and Environmental Microbiology.
